GOVERNOR PAWLENTY REAPPOINTS TWO TO THE BOARD OF MARRIAGE AND FAMILY THERAPY -- January 25, 2007
 

Governor Tim Pawlenty today announced the reappointment of Manijeh Daneshpour and Sonia Hohnadel to the Board of Marriage and Family Therapy.

Manijeh Daneshpour, of Maple Grove, is a Professor and Director of the Marriage and Family Therapy Program at St. Cloud State University. A licensed marriage and family therapist since 1996, Dr. Daneshpour also works as a therapist in private practice in Maple Grove. She holds a Ph.D. in Family Social Science from the University of Minnesota. Dr. Daneshpour fills a board position for a marriage and family therapist. She will serve a four-year term ending in January 2011.

Sonia Hohnadel, of Moorhead, currently serves as communications coordinator and administrative assistant to the Provost of Tri-College University of Fargo/Moorhead. She also serves on the board of directors of the Minnesota Minority Education Partnership, Inc. Ms. Hohnadel also serves on the Council on Affairs of Chicano/Latino People. Hohnadel is appointed to a board position for a public member and will serve a four-year term ending in January 2011.

The Minnesota Board of Marriage and Family Therapy is responsible for licensing and disciplining marriage and family therapists. The board is made up of seven members appointed by the Governor.
